Questione : La difficoltà con va all'annotazione relativa

Ho tre tabelle, fatture, pagamenti e PaymentsXInvoices riferiti.  La fattura nessuna è il PK per le fatture ed è le FK nei pagamenti e in paymentsxinvoices.  Il pagamento nessun è il PK nei pagamenti e le FK in invoicexpayments.  Sulla disposizione della fattura ho un portale per i paymentsxinvoices, con i campi sul portale dai pagamenti.  Così quando un pagamento è registrato il portale ha soltanto quei pagamenti appartenere alla fattura ed i campi sull'esposizione portale il pagamento specifico.  Ho uno scritto che è supposto per andare al pagamento specifico quando l'utente scatta sopra il campo di pagamento che è sul portale.  Il problema è che va sempre alla prima annotazione di pagamento per quella fattura.  Perché? class= del

Risposta : La difficoltà con va all'annotazione relativa

È il vostro “sottoscritto di Globals libero di pagamento„ che funziona vicino alla parte superiore dello scritto.  Questo sottoscritto rompe il contesto con il portale, in modo da quando lo scritto più successivamente ottiene al punto di GTRR, non conosce quale fila portale comportarsi sopra, in modo da esso va sempre alla prima annotazione.

Alla parte superiore del vostro scritto, bloccare il nome del portale (che regolate nella finestra dell'oggetto Info, accessibile dal menu di vista) using ottengono (ActiveLayoutObjectName) ed il numero della fila portale volete lo scritto comportarti sul usando ottenete (PortalRowNumber).

Dopo che il sottoscritto ha funzionato ed appena prima il punto dello scritto di GTRR, andare indietro all'oggetto portale (using andare obiettare) ed alla fila portale corretta (using andare alla fila portale).

Ovviamente, state andando avere bisogno di di mettere un tasto (o fare uno dei campi o di intera fila “clickable ") sul portale in moda da potere funzionare lo scritto per una fila portale specifica.

Spero che questo aiuti!
Altre soluzioni  
 
programming4us programming4us